System Requirements Document

1. Introduction

This document outlines the system requirements for the AI-Powered Dental Clinic Management System. The platform is designed to streamline and automate the daily operations of a dental clinic through intelligent workflows, patient management, AI-assisted clinical documentation, treatment monitoring, communication systems, appointment scheduling, inventory management, billing, insurance administration, and operational analytics.

2. System Overview

The system will support both light and dark themes with a toggle button for users to switch between them. The AI-Powered Dental Clinic Management System is a centralized platform that functions as a unified operational workspace for dentists, orthodontists, assistants, receptionists, inventory managers, clinic administrators, and patients. It aims to reduce administrative burdens, improve treatment visibility, enhance patient engagement, and provide AI-powered assistance while ensuring all clinical decisions remain under professional supervision. The system will be deployed as a responsive Single Page Application (SPA) optimized for desktop, tablet, and mobile devices.

Security and Authentication:

  • I want secure login, password recovery, and session management to protect user data.
  • I want multi-factor authentication and role-based permissions to enhance security.
  • I want activity logging, device session tracking, and encrypted data transmission to ensure data integrity.
  • I want audit trail management to track all system activities.
  • I want JWT-based authentication with refresh token support for secure API access.
  • I want the minimum necessary access standard enforced via RBAC to protect sensitive information.

Development and Deployment:

  • I want a CI/CD pipeline using GitHub Actions or equivalent for efficient deployment.
  • I want environment-based configuration management to handle different deployment stages.
  • I want a zero-downtime deployment strategy to ensure continuous availability.
  • I want three environments (development, staging, and production) for testing and deployment.

Testing and Compliance:

  • I want integration testing for all API endpoints to ensure system reliability.
  • I want performance testing to ensure page loads under 2 seconds on standard connections.
  • I want security penetration testing before production launch to identify vulnerabilities.
  • I want a HIPAA security risk assessment before go-live to ensure compliance.
  • I want HITECH Act compliance for all business associates to protect patient information.

10. Tech Stack

  • Frontend: React.js (Single Page Application).
  • Backend: Python with FastAPI.
  • Primary Database: PostgreSQL.
  • Caching & Session Management: Redis.
  • Real-Time Communication: WebSocket (Socket.io).
  • Cloud Provider: AWS (HIPAA-eligible infrastructure).
  • AI Services: OpenAI API, Whisper, custom vision models.
  • File Storage: AWS S3.
  • Component library: shadcn/ui or Ant Design.
